What Exactly Is a Tractor BBQ Grill?

A Tractor BBQ Grill is a charcoal-powered outdoor cooker meticulously shaped to resemble a vintage farm tractor—often modeled after classic 1940s to 1960s tractors like the Farmall or John Deere series. The design faithfully replicates key tractor elements: oversized rear wheels with aggressive treads, a smaller front axle, a prominent front grille, dual headlights (often decorative or functional LED accents), a sloped hood that lifts to reveal the firebox, and even a simulated steering wheel or seat. Despite its playful appearance, it operates with serious grilling capability: the fire chamber is typically located beneath the hood or in the engine compartment area, while the main cooking grate resides in the “tractor body” or behind a side-access door. Many models include secondary warming racks, ash collection trays, and adjustable air vents for precise temperature control.

Maintenance Tips for Long-Lasting Performance

To preserve both function and appearance, routine care is essential:

  • After Each Use: Allow the grill to cool completely, then brush grates with a stainless-steel brush. Empty the ash tray to prevent buildup and moisture retention.
  • Monthly Inspection: Check wheel axles, hinges, and handle joints for rust or stiffness. Apply food-safe lubricant if needed.
  • Seasonal Deep Cleaning: Wipe exterior surfaces with mild soapy water and a soft cloth—avoid abrasive pads that scratch painted finishes. For stubborn grease, use a vinegar-water solution (1:1).
  • Winter Storage: If not in year-round use, cover with a breathable, waterproof grill cover. Store in a dry garage or shed. For extended storage, coat cast-iron parts with a thin layer of food-grade oil to prevent oxidation.
  • Paint Touch-Ups: Use high-heat spray paint (rated for 1,200°F+) for minor chips—match the original color as closely as possible.

Safety Considerations for Responsible Grilling

Given its unique shape and often elevated cooking surface, extra caution ensures safe operation:

  • Place the grill on a non-combustible, level surface (e.g., stone pavers or concrete), at least 10 feet from structures, dry grass, or overhanging branches.
  • Keep children and pets at a safe distance—not because the grill is dangerous, but because its friendly design may invite curiosity.
  • Use long-handled tools to avoid reaching over hot surfaces, especially near the hood opening.
  • Never leave a lit grill unattended, and always have a fire extinguisher or bucket of sand nearby.
